首页 >电脑 >c语言如何给函数参改名
用户头像
小明同学生活达人
发布于 2024-12-03 20:05:41

c语言如何给函数参改名

c语言如何给函数参改名?

浏览 3060440收藏 8

回答 (1)

用户头像
知识达人专家
回答于 2024-12-03 20:05:41

在C语言编程中,给函数参数重命名是一项常见的任务,它能让代码的可读性和可维护性大大提高。本文将探讨几种给函数参数重命名的方法,并总结最佳实践。

首先,为何要给函数参数重命名?函数参数的命名应当能清晰表达其含义,当函数的作用域较大,或参数较多时,好的参数命名能极大减少阅读和理解代码的难度。以下是如何给函数参数重命名的一些步骤和技巧:

  1. 明确参数含义:首先明确每个参数的作用和含义,这是重命名的基础。如果参数含义不清,即使名称再优雅也无法解决问题。
  2. 遵循命名规范:使用有意义的单词组合,避免使用缩写或单个字母。例如,将表示文件大小的参数命名为fileSize而非fs
  3. 使用类型后缀:在参数名称的末尾添加类型后缀,可以提高代码的可读性。如widthInPixelsvelocityMps
  4. 考虑上下文:根据函数的上下文环境来命名参数。如果函数用于处理图形,那么pointXpointY可能就是合适的命名。
  5. 避免歧义:避免使用可能产生歧义的名称,如tempvalue等过于泛化的词汇。
  6. 参数个数处理:如果函数参数过多,考虑将相关参数封装为结构体,这样可以通过结构体字段名称来描述参数,减少参数个数。

重命名函数参数的具体步骤如下:

  1. 备份原始代码:在进行任何重命名之前,备份原始代码,以免发生意外。
  2. 使用IDE的重命名功能:现代IDE通常具有重命名功能,可以在项目中全局更改标识符,确保所有引用都得到更新。
  3. 手动检查引用:即使使用IDE,也应手动检查每个引用,确保没有遗漏或错误发生。
  4. 单元测试:在重命名后,运行单元测试来验证函数仍然按预期工作。

总之,给C语言函数参数重命名是提升代码质量的重要步骤。通过遵循以上建议,我们不仅可以使代码更易于理解和维护,也能在一定程度上避免未来代码重构时的问题。

回答被采纳

评论 (2)

用户头像
小明同学1小时前

非常感谢您的详细建议!我很喜欢。

用户头像
小花农45分钟前

不错的回答我认为你可以在仔细的回答一下

当前用户头像

分享你的回答